Bihar Police Holds Awareness Program to Prevent Sexual Harassment of Women at Workplaces

DGP Vinay Kumar and senior officials emphasize women’s safety and POSH Act compliance, district-level training programs to be strengthened

Patna: The Bihar Police has demonstrated its strong commitment to preventing sexual harassment of women at workplaces. A special awareness and sensitization program was held on Tuesday at the Sardar Patel Bhavan auditorium, focusing on creating safer work environments for women.

The program was attended by senior police officials, legal experts, and representatives of women’s welfare organizations.

DGP Vinay Kumar Highlights Women’s Safety

The chief guest, Director General of Police (DGP) Vinay Kumar, emphasized the importance of providing complete security to women at workplaces. He said, “Respecting women is everyone’s duty, and safeguarding their dignity in professional spaces is a priority for the police.”

The program focused on the Sexual Harassment of Women at Workplace (Prevention, Prohibition and Redressal) Act, 2013 (POSH Act), aiming to create awareness and sensitize law enforcement officials and the public about its provisions.

Program Organized by ADG Amit Kumar Jain

The event was organized under the leadership of ADG (Vulnerable Groups) Amit Kumar Jain. Key speakers included:

  • SP Amir Javed
  • Assistant Inspector General (Welfare) Smita Suman
  • SPC Ankit Kashyap
  • Vandana Sharma from Aakanksha Seva Sadan
  • Advocate Sakshit Ali

The program was attended by women police personnel from BISAP and other senior officials, highlighting the department’s focus on gender-sensitive policing.

Focus on Awareness and Training

The program also provided guidance on conducting awareness and sensitization programs at the district level, encouraging local police units to organize POSH Act training sessions and workshops.

Officials underlined the importance of establishing Internal Committees (ICs) at workplaces, educating employees about their rights, and ensuring mechanisms are in place to report and address complaints effectively.

Strengthening Women-Friendly Policing

The initiative reflects Bihar Police’s proactive approach in promoting a safe and respectful work environment for women. By combining legal education, awareness programs, and active participation of women officers, the police aim to prevent sexual harassment and uphold the dignity of women in every workplace across the state.
